use super::deployment::DeploymentId;
use std::collections::HashMap;
use std::sync::RwLock;
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Copy, PartialEq, Eq)]
pub enum FallbackType {
General,
ContextWindow,
ContentPolicy,
RateLimit,
}
#[derive(Debug, Clone)]
pub struct ExecutionResult<T> {
pub result: T,
pub deployment_id: DeploymentId,
pub attempts: u32,
pub model_used: String,
pub used_fallback: bool,
pub latency_us: u64,
}
#[derive(Debug, Default)]
pub struct FallbackConfig {
general: RwLock<HashMap<String, Vec<String>>>,
context_window: RwLock<HashMap<String, Vec<String>>>,
content_policy: RwLock<HashMap<String, Vec<String>>>,
rate_limit: RwLock<HashMap<String, Vec<String>>>,
}
impl FallbackConfig {
pub fn new() -> Self {
Self {
general: RwLock::new(HashMap::new()),
context_window: RwLock::new(HashMap::new()),
content_policy: RwLock::new(HashMap::new()),
rate_limit: RwLock::new(HashMap::new()),
}
}
pub fn add_general(self, model: &str, fallbacks: Vec<String>) -> Self {
self.general
.write()
.unwrap_or_else(|e| e.into_inner())
.insert(model.to_string(), fallbacks);
self
}
pub fn add_context_window(self, model: &str, fallbacks: Vec<String>) -> Self {
self.context_window
.write()
.unwrap_or_else(|e| e.into_inner())
.insert(model.to_string(), fallbacks);
self
}
pub fn add_content_policy(self, model: &str, fallbacks: Vec<String>) -> Self {
self.content_policy
.write()
.unwrap_or_else(|e| e.into_inner())
.insert(model.to_string(), fallbacks);
self
}
pub fn add_rate_limit(self, model: &str, fallbacks: Vec<String>) -> Self {
self.rate_limit
.write()
.unwrap_or_else(|e| e.into_inner())
.insert(model.to_string(), fallbacks);
self
}
#[allow(clippy::type_complexity)]
pub fn validate(&self) -> Result<(), Vec<String>> {
let mut errors = Vec::new();
let maps: [(&str, &RwLock<HashMap<String, Vec<String>>>); 4] = [
("general", &self.general),
("context_window", &self.context_window),
("content_policy", &self.content_policy),
("rate_limit", &self.rate_limit),
];
for (label, lock) in &maps {
let map = lock.read().unwrap_or_else(|e| e.into_inner());
for start in map.keys() {
let mut visited = std::collections::HashSet::new();
visited.insert(start.clone());
let mut stack = vec![start.clone()];
while let Some(node) = stack.pop() {
if let Some(targets) = map.get(&node) {
for target in targets {
if !visited.insert(target.clone()) {
errors.push(format!(
"{label}: cycle involving '{start}' -> '{target}'"
));
} else {
stack.push(target.clone());
}
}
}
}
}
}
if errors.is_empty() {
Ok(())
} else {
Err(errors)
}
}
pub fn get_fallbacks_for_type(
&self,
model_name: &str,
fallback_type: FallbackType,
) -> Vec<String> {
let lock = match fallback_type {
FallbackType::General => &self.general,
FallbackType::ContextWindow => &self.context_window,
FallbackType::ContentPolicy => &self.content_policy,
FallbackType::RateLimit => &self.rate_limit,
};
lock.read()
.unwrap_or_else(|e| e.into_inner())
.get(model_name)
.cloned()
.unwrap_or_default()
}
}
